
Expanded Talk on Expanded Cinema
Inspired by Bill Viola’s Moving Stillness: Mount Rainier 1979, light and sound artist Rachael Guma will give an interactive talk and brief history of “expanded cinema,” a term used to describe a film, video, multimedia performance or an immersive environment that pushes the boundaries of cinema. The program includes hands-on experience with various analogue technologies for creating cinematic art, culminating in a collaborative performance.
Recommended for ages 10+.
